Findlay staff outlines $150,000 'Urban Prairie' grant with Toledo Zoo support

Findlay City Finance Committee · February 4,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

Staff told the committee the city received a one‑off $150,000 grant to create an 'Urban Prairie' on city‑owned flood‑remediation property; the grant covers planting, signage, walking paths and three years of maintenance by the Toledo Zoo's Wild Toledo program.

Council staff updated the finance committee on a one‑time grant opportunity identified through contacts at the US Conference of Mayors. The 'Urban Prairie' grant would fund a restoration and education project on city‑owned property on East Main Cross that requires flood remediation.
